C timsort

WebQuestions tagged [timsort] Timsort is a sorting algorithm invented by Tim Peters, designed to take advantage of partial ordering in data. It has an average-case complexity of Θ (nlogn) and worst-case complexity of O (nlogn). Learn more…. WebTim-sort is a sorting algorithm derived from insertion sort and merge sort. It was designed to perform optimally on different kind of real-world data. Tim sort is an adaptive sorting …

ティムソート - Wikipedia

WebJun 27, 2015 · Timsort is one of the best sorting algorithms in terms of complexity and stability. Unlike “bubble” or “insertion” sorting, Timsort is rather new — it was invented in 2002 by Tim Peters (and named after him). It has been a standard sorting algorithm in Python, OpenJDK 7 and Android JDK 1.5 ever since. And to understand why, one should ... how many calories are burned hula hooping https://thriftydeliveryservice.com

Is Java 7 using Tim Sort for the Method Arrays.Sort?

WebThe npm package @types/timsort receives a total of 8,889 downloads a week. As such, we scored @types/timsort popularity level to be Recognized. Based on project statistics from the GitHub repository for the npm package @types/timsort, we found that it has been starred 43,594 times. ... WebHow to use timsort - 9 common examples To help you get started, we’ve selected a few timsort examples, based on popular ways it is used in public projects. Secure your code … WebAug 24, 2024 · Timsort’s time complexity is recorded at O(n log (n)), making it’s average time complexity equal to that of Quicksort and Mergesort; in best-case scenarios, whether negligible or not, Timsort ... how many calories are burned ice skating

Top 5 timsort Code Examples Snyk

Category:Timsort - 维基百科,自由的百科全书

Tags:C timsort

C timsort

V8 內的排序演算法 — Timsort

WebMar 22, 2014 · Java 7 uses Dual-Pivot Quicksort for primitives and TimSort for objects. According to the Java 7 API doc for primitives: Implementation note: The sorting algorithm is a Dual-Pivot Quicksort by Vladimir Yaroslavskiy, Jon Bentley, and Joshua Bloch. This algorithm offers O(n log(n)) performance on many data sets that cause other quicksorts … WebDec 24, 2024 · NCBI C++ Toolkit Cross Reference. Generated by the LXR 2.3.5. — Indexed on 2024-12-24 05:14:12 UTC Indexed on 2024-12-24 05:14:12 UTC

C timsort

Did you know?

http://www.uwenku.com/question/p-ypmgxxyf-hy.html WebTimsort 是一种混合稳定的排序算法,源自合并排序和插入排序,旨在较好地处理真实世界中各种各样的数据。 它使用了 Peter Mcllroy 的"乐观排序和信息理论上复杂性"中的技术,参见 第四届年度ACM-SIAM离散算法研讨会论文集 ,第467-474页,1993年。

WebMar 13, 2024 · 要用 Rust 写一个区块链,需要以下步骤: 1. 了解区块链的基本原理,包括区块、链、共识机制等。 2. 定义区块链的数据结构,包括区块和链。 WebFind the best open-source package for your project with Snyk Open Source Advisor. Explore over 1 million open source packages.

Webwolfsort is a hybrid stable radixsort / fluxsort with improved performance on random data. It's mostly a proof of concept that only works on unsigned 32 bit integers. glidesort is a hybrid stable quicksort / timsort written in Rust. The timsort is enhanced with quadsort's bidirectional branchless merge logic. WebFeb 22, 2024 · The Timsort is a stable sorting algorithm that uses the idea of merge sort and insertion sort. It can also be called a hybrid algorithm of insertion and merge sort. It is widely used in Java, Python, C, and C++ inbuilt sort algorithms. The idea behind this algorithm is to sort small chunks using insertion sort and then merge all the big chunks ...

WebBest Java code snippets using java.util.TimSort (Showing top 20 results out of 315)

WebSummary: quadsort does well at both random and ordered data, and excels on small arrays in the 100-1000 range. timsort is good at ordered data, not so good at random data. pdqsort does not defeat complex patterns, good at medium and large arrays. ska_sort excels at random data on large arrays but not so good at small arrays and medium arrays. how many calories are burned kayakingWebJun 8, 2012 · Python uses an algorithm called Timsort: Timsort is a hybrid sorting algorithm, derived from merge sort and insertion sort, designed to perform well on many kinds of real-world data. It was invented by Tim Peters in 2002 for use in the Python programming language. The algorithm finds subsets of the data that are already … high quality electric baritone ukulelesWebThis is the best method for sorting small numbers. /// of elements. It requires O (n log n) compares, but O (n^2) data. /// movement (worst case). ///. /// If the initial part of the specified range is already sorted, /// this method … how many calories are burned during sleepWebThis video is brought to you by CookitCS, the Intro to Computer Science course - presented by Timurul HK and Noel T.A brief runthrough of the Timsort algorit... how many calories are burned in a 20 min walkWebIntroduction to Sorting Algorithms in PythonLiam Pulsifer 13:50. Mark as Completed. Supporting Material. Description. Transcript. Comments & Discussion. Here are resources for more information about Timsort: CPython source code: objects/listobject.c Timsort: Wikipedia article Timsort: Original explanation Complete Analysis on How to Pick min ... how many calories are burned in a 3 mile walkWebDec 8, 2024 · A Verified Timsort C Implementation in Isabelle/HOL. Formal verification of traditional algorithms are of great significance due to their wide application in state-of-the … how many calories are burned playing chessWebمن الproblems التي تواجهنا أحيانا في الproblem solving هي الad hoc problems و هي problems لا تخضع لاي تصنيف من التصنيفات المعروفة ... how many calories are burned in sauna